An industrial hydraulic lift is a mechanical device that uses hydraulic fluid under pressure to raise, lower, or position heavy loads. The system operates on Pascal’s law: pressure applied to a confined fluid is transmitted equally in all directions. A typical hydraulic lift consists of a hydraulic cylinder, pump, control valves, and fluid reservoir. When the pump forces hydraulic fluid into the cylinder, the piston extends, lifting the load. These systems are widely used in stationary applications (e.g., loading docks, assembly lines), mobile equipment (e.g., forklifts, aerial work platforms), and portable lifting solutions.
Industrial hydraulic lifts are integral to sectors such as manufacturing, construction, warehousing, logistics, energy, mining, automotive, and aerospace. They are available in diverse configurations, including scissor lifts, boom lifts, vertical lifts, truck-mounted lifts, and custom systems tailored to specific industrial applications.

One of the most significant trends is the increasing adoption of IoT-enabled lift systems. These systems feature sensors for real-time monitoring, predictive maintenance alerts, and remote operational control, significantly reducing unplanned downtime and improving workplace safety. Smart hydraulic lifts can communicate with facility management systems, optimizing maintenance schedules based on actual usage rather than fixed intervals.
Environmental concerns and regulatory pressures are driving a shift toward biodegradable hydraulic fluids and energy-efficient lift designs. Manufacturers are developing systems that consume less power, reduce fluid leakage, and incorporate variable-speed pump drives that adjust energy consumption based on load demands.
Modular and compact hydraulic lifts are gaining popularity as they offer better space utilization and easier installation in confined industrial environments. This trend is particularly evident in retrofitting existing facilities where floor space is at a premium.
Hydraulic lifts are increasingly integrated with Automated Guided Vehicles (AGVs) and robotic material handling systems. This integration reflects the broader trend toward automation in manufacturing and logistics, where lifts are no longer standalone devices but components of fully automated work cells.
Customized hydraulic lift solutions for niche industrial applications are becoming more prominent, reflecting industry-specific requirements. From cleanroom-compatible lifts in pharmaceutical manufacturing to explosion-proof systems in chemical plants, customization is a key differentiator.

Threat of New Entrants (Medium): Moderate barriers to entry exist. While established players benefit from brand recognition and distribution networks, local manufacturers in developing countries can enter the market with lower-cost products. However, meeting safety standards and certification requirements presents a challenge.
Bargaining Power of Buyers (Medium–High): Large industrial buyers, particularly in automotive and logistics, have significant negotiating power due to the availability of multiple suppliers. However, the need for reliable, safety-certified equipment limits buyer leverage in premium segments.
Bargaining Power of Suppliers (Medium): Suppliers of steel, aluminum, and hydraulic components (cylinders, pumps, valves) have moderate power. The 2026 conflict has increased supplier power in the steel and aluminum segments due to supply disruptions. However, the presence of multiple global suppliers for hydraulic components keeps pressure moderate.
Threat of Substitutes (Medium): Electric lifts, pneumatic lifts, and magnetic lifting systems can substitute for hydraulic lifts in certain applications. However, hydraulic systems remain superior for heavy loads, precise control, and harsh environments. The threat is higher in light-duty applications.
Intensity of Rivalry (High): The market is highly competitive with numerous global and regional players. Competition is based on price, product quality, innovation (IoT integration, energy efficiency), and after-sales service.
Raw Material Extraction & Processing: Production of steel (for frames, cylinders, platforms) and aluminum (for lightweight components). These materials are highly sensitive to energy costs and geopolitical disruptions. China dominates steel production, while the Gulf region accounts for approximately 8–9% of global primary aluminum supply.
Component Manufacturing: Production of hydraulic cylinders, pumps, valves, hoses, seals, control systems, sensors, and electric motors. These components are often sourced from specialized suppliers (e.g., Bosch Rexroth, Parker Hannifin).
System Assembly & Integration: Assembly of complete hydraulic lift systems, including structural fabrication, hydraulic circuit integration, electrical wiring (for smart systems), and safety system installation. Major assembly occurs in China, USA, Germany, Japan, and Italy.
Distribution & Sales: Distribution through direct sales forces (for large custom systems), specialized industrial equipment distributors, and increasingly through e-commerce platforms for standardized products.
Installation & Commissioning: On-site installation, particularly for stationary lifts (e.g., loading docks, vertical lifts), requires trained technicians. Mobile lifts are typically delivered ready for use.
Maintenance & After-Sales Service: Recurring revenue from service contracts, spare parts (seals, hoses, filters, hydraulic fluid), and periodic inspections. Predictive maintenance using IoT sensors is an emerging trend.
End-of-Life & Recycling: Steel and aluminum components are highly recyclable, but hydraulic fluids require proper disposal. Increasing environmental regulations are pushing for closed-loop fluid management systems.
The escalation of the USA-Israel-Iran conflict in early 2026 has created unprecedented and severe disruptions across the global industrial hydraulic lift market. Unlike previous regional tensions, this conflict has directly impacted three critical aspects of the hydraulic lift value chain: steel and aluminum supply, energy costs, and logistics.
The Gulf region accounts for approximately 8–9% of global primary aluminum supply — a material essential for lightweight hydraulic lift components, aerial work platforms, and structural elements. The conflict has caused direct damage to production facilities:
Emirates Global Aluminium (EGA) — the largest aluminum producer in the Middle East — has entirely halted production following attacks on its Al Taweelah facility, which is being assessed for significant damage.
Aluminium Bahrain (Alba) , confirmed as a target of Iranian IRGC strikes, initiated a shutdown of three smelting lines in early March 2026, accounting for 19 per cent of its capacity.
Qatar’s Qatalum facility has stabilised operations at approximately 60 per cent of nameplate capacity.
London Metal Exchange (LME) aluminum prices have surged to a four-year high, exceeding USD 3,372 per tonne, with physical premiums moving sharply higher. Goldman Sachs estimates that a one-month full shutdown in the Middle East could push aluminum prices temporarily to USD 3,600 per tonne, with Citigroup warning of a potential spike to USD 4,000 per tonne.
The impact extends beyond direct production: Gulf smelters rely on imported alumina (the raw material for aluminum refining) that also transits the Strait of Hormuz. Inventories typically last only a few weeks, meaning logistics disruptions — even without physical damage to plants — can rapidly threaten production continuity.
Steel is doubly exposed to the conflict: it is both energy-intensive to produce and freight-sensitive to deliver. The correlation between oil and steel prices is well-established: from May 2021 to May 2022, a 66 per cent rise in crude oil prices was accompanied by a roughly 75 per cent rise in steel prices.
Israeli air strikes have destroyed approximately 70% of Iran's steel production capacity. Additionally, higher electricity and gas costs raise production costs at blast furnaces and electric arc furnaces worldwide, while shipowners avoiding the Strait of Hormuz repriced insurance and bunker costs, raising delivered prices and extending lead times.
The Strait of Hormuz — through which approximately 20 million barrels of crude oil per day (about 20–30 per cent of global seaborne oil trade) and significant volumes of metals and industrial goods transit — has been effectively closed to commercial shipping.
Dubai, Doha, Kuwait City, and Jeddah — key logistics hubs for freight movement — are located on the other side of the strait. Traffic through the strait has ground almost to a halt.
Approximately 500,000 tonnes of aluminum transited the Strait of Hormuz annually, destined for 70 countries across Asia, Europe, and North America. This supply has been severely disrupted.
Rerouting cargo through alternative routes could extend shipping times by 10–14 days and significantly increase container costs.
Crude futures jumped by nearly 22% in the first week of March 2026 as markets priced in Gulf risk. Higher energy costs cascade through the entire industrial hydraulic lift value chain: steel and aluminum production, component manufacturing, assembly, and freight.
